How does it work?

  • Simply go around the room, and ask each person to share one accomplishment they had before they turned 18.
  • Undoubtedly you’ll get some of lesser importance, like “I bought a skateboard,” but you never know what hidden skills you might discover in your colleagues.

When to use it?

Before a meeting <18y is an engaging and unique way to encourage team members to share fun or interesting stories with one another.

How long does it take?

2m per round

Too Many Cooks

How does it work?

  • Create a anonymous access Miro or Jamboard (it’s really important to go in anonymous).
  • Upload a photo of your favourite meal there
  • Once everyone is done, go round trying to guess who added each

When to use it?

This is a fun icebreaker for people who don’t know each other and have just been introduced.

How long does it take?

Two minutes per round.

Two Truths and a Lie

Use icebreaker

How does it work?

  • Ask each participant to write down three statements about themselves on three sticky notes. Two should be true, and one of them is a lie.
  • Ask everyone to add a dot vote next to which statement they think is the lie.
  • Once everyone has voted, reveal the correct answer and give team members the chance to ask any follow-up questions!

When to use it?

This is a fun icebreaker for people who don’t know each other and have just been introduced. It’s a great way for individuals to showcase their fun, non-work related side!

How long does it take?

Allow five minutes for one round, with a bit of time for story telling!

Grab and Share / Show and Tell

https://www.maxpixel.net/White-Background-Man-White-Arm-Hand-Grab-5244175

How does it work?

  • When on a video call, have everyone grab something that is within arm’s reach.
  • Take turns telling a story about that item: Where/when did you get it? Is it meaningful?
  • If you’re on multiple calls with similar people and choose this activity, make sure to grab something new to share each time.

When to use it?

It’s a great way for individuals to showcase their fun, non-work related side!

How long does it take?

2 minutes each

Company Icebreakers

If the idea is for the team to get to know your/their own company better:

Aliens have landed

https://pixabay.com/illustrations/ufos-aliens-alien-woman-abduction-5795690/

How does it work?

  • Tell the group to imagine aliens have landed on Earth and want to learn about your company. But since they don’t speak English or understand what you do, it needs to be explained with five symbols or pictures.
  • Ask each participant to draw five simple images that best describe and communicate your company’s products and culture to a shared Jamboard
  • Take a few minutes and look at all the images and talk through common themes. This is a great trivia game that really lights a fire to the group chat during a virtual meeting.

When to use it?

This game can help teams with language and cultural differences strengthen the company culture

How long does it take?

5 minutes per round

Tell a great company story

How does it work?

  • Ask each participant (or pick one a day) to share a great company experience with the group.
  • Maybe it was a brainstorming session with peers that led to a breakthrough product idea, an amazing customer service experience or a time when a team member chipped in to help get a project done under a deadline.

When to use it?

If you want to stay focused on company-talk. These stories can help people feel more engaged with their teams and give employees a chance to celebrate themselves and their peers.

How long does it take?

5 minutes per round
